上个月我使用了下面的php函数,

$currmonth = date('m', strtotime('-1 month'));

它工作得很好,直到昨天我才得到04的价值。在今天5月31日(5月的最后一天),我注意到函数只返回当前月份。那是05。是否有其他替代函数可以准确返回上个月的数据。

最佳答案

试试strtotime("first day of last month")
first day of是非常重要的一部分。

08-26 19:45